Job Summary

This role involves ensuring the safe and compliant handling, storage, and disposal of chemical, hazardous, and radioactive waste within the internationally recognized Max Planck Institute for Biochemistry. The specialist will be responsible for the independent collection, sorting, and precise documentation of laboratory waste, including solvents, chemicals, and batteries. Key duties include maintaining the operational readiness of the central chemical and waste storage facility (Ex-area), organizing specialized waste removal, and overseeing dangerous goods transportation via road (ADR) and air (IATA). The ideal candidate has practical experience with chemicals and logistics, is highly organized, and will act as the Radiation Protection Officer for radioactive waste collection, ensuring strict adherence to legal and safety regulations. This is a secure, full-time position offering flexible hours in an international research environment near Munich.
